Cheapest Available Graysville Apartments for Rent and Nearby

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in Graysville, IN is a 1 Bed unit found at Anthony Square Senior Apartments in the Downtown Terre Haute neighborhood priced from $525. Union Pointe in the Downtown Terre Haute ne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$550.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Graysville apartments for rent:

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Graysville Apartments

What is the Cheapest Studio apartment in Graysville?

Currently the most affordable Cheap Studio Apartment in Graysville is at Willow Crossings listed at $670.

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Graysville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Graysville Apartment is $525 at Anthony Square Senior Apartments.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Graysville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Graysville is starting from $610 at Arbors at Honey Creek.

What is the most affordable Graysville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ap Graysville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at Arbors at Honey Creek and starts from $706.
